Awesome JavaScript Multimedia

  • ffmpeg.wasm ffmpeg.wasm 12,338
    star
    updated 3 months ago MIT License

    FFmpeg for browser, powered by WebAssembly

  • updated about 1 year ago Other

    An HTML5 saveAs() FileSaver implementation

  • glfx.js glfx.js 3,189
    star
    updated 6 months ago MIT License

    An image effects library for JavaScript using WebGL

  • updated about 4 years ago Other

    A modern, simple and elegant WYSIWYG rich text editor.

  • jsmpeg jsmpeg 6,222
    star
    updated over 1 year ago MIT License

    MPEG1 Video Decoder in JavaScript

  • updated over 1 year ago BSD 2-Clause "Sim...

    Draws simple SVG sequence diagrams from textual representation of the diagram

  • ocrad.js ocrad.js 3,451
    star
    updated over 3 years ago GNU General Publi...

    OCR in Javascript via Emscripten

  • updated over 3 years ago

    Create an Apple-like one page scroller website (iPhone 5S website) with One Page Scroll plugin

  • osc.js osc.js 718
    star
    updated 8 months ago GNU General Publi...

    An Open Sound Control (OSC) library for JavaScript that works in both the browser and Node.js

  • p5.js p5.js 20,599
    star
    updated 3 months ago GNU Lesser Genera...

    p5.js is a client-side JS platform that empowers artists, designers, students, and anyone to learn to code and express themselves creatively on the web. It is based on the core principles of Processing. http://twitter.com/p5xjs —

  • RecordRTC RecordRTC 6,333
    star
    updated 2 months ago MIT License

    RecordRTC is WebRTC JavaScript library for audio/video as well as screen activity recording. It supports Chrome, Firefox, Opera, Android, and Microsoft Edge. Platforms: Linux, Mac and Windows.

  • updated over 1 year ago MIT License

    A real-time, node-based video effects compositor for the web built with HTML5, Javascript and WebGL

  • updated 2 months ago MIT License

    📡 Simple WebRTC video, voice, and data channels

  • three.js three.js 98,690
    star
    updated 11 days ago MIT License

    JavaScript 3D Library.

  • video.js video.js 37,092
    star
    updated 16 days ago Other

    Video.js - open source HTML5 video player

  • updated about 2 months ago MIT License

    video.js plugin for recording audio/video/image files